French Fitness PS50 Pit Shark Belt Squat Machine (New) Product Overview Experience a new level of strength training with the French Fitness PS50 Pit Shark Belt Squat Machine. This innovative piece of equipment allows you to effectively train your lower body while minimizing stress on your lumbar spine, shoulders, and torso. Designed for serious fitness enthusiasts, it’s perfect for achieving your squat goals in a safe and efficient manner. Key Features and Details Constructed from 2.5 mm heavy-duty steel for maximum durability Electrostatically powder-coated finish enhances adhesion and longevity Wide squat platform with tread grooves for stability and grip Four weight plate storage horns for quick and convenient weight changes Design, Use, and Product Experience The PS50 Pit Shark Belt Squat Machine stands out with its robust design. The heavy-duty steel construction ensures it can withstand intense workouts. The platform’s unique tread grooves provide exceptional grip, making your squats secure and stable. This machine is designed for seamless performance, allowing you to focus on your workout without worrying about safety. The weight storage horns facilitate quick adjustments, making it easy to switch up your resistance mid-set for a more dynamic training session.
